ENWIN Utilities Ltd., is currently accepting applications for the vacant position of:

Temporary Regulatory Analyst (Temporary contract length – 36 months)

Location: Windsor, ON (Hybrid)

Reporting to the Manager Regulatory Affairs, the successful candidate will be responsible to support the Regulatory Department by monitoring regulatory developments within the electricity industry (Ontario Energy Board, Ministry of Energy and Mines, etc.) and engage with internal and external stakeholders to understand impacts and advance business outcomes. This position is responsible for ensuring new regulatory requirements are communicated and implemented internally, as well as ensuring ongoing compliance through effective follow-up and monitoring activities. The Temporary Regulatory Analyst will prepare and oversee the development of components of electricity rate applications, and the preparation, consolidation, and submission of regulatory reports to ensure compliance. This position requires the successful candidate to utilize critical thinking and judgement skills on a regular basis.
